3rd Soil Symposium: Healthy Soils for Our Prosperity takes place in Adama on 6 and 7 March

04.03.2025

 

On 6 and 7 March 2025, the 3rd Soil Symposium is taking place in Adama, Ethiopia. This year’s Soil Symposium is organised and hosted by the Ministry of Agriculture of Ethiopia and provides a platform for reasearchers, practitioners and policy makers to present and exchange their experiences with biochar-based fertilizers for the regeneration of soil fertility in Ethiopia. Ongoing research supported by the ETH-Soil project is presented as well as further research conducted in Ethiopia. Furthermore, the Soil Symposium will include presentations on the topics of geo-information for resource screening and soil mapping, bonechar as phosporous fertilizer and the amelioration of acid soils. We are looking forward to a productive and enlightening exchange with our presenters and participants. With over 120 registrations, this Soil Symposium will be the biggest yet.
